The United States Department of Agriculture (USDA) Forest Service is soliciting quotes for Janitorial Services located at the Hodgen Office on the Oklahoma Ranger District, Ouachita National Forest.


(I) This is a combined synopsis/solicitation for commercial items prepared in accordance with the format in FAR Subpart 12.6, as supplemented with additional information included in this notice and in accordance with the simplified acquisition procedures authorized in FAR Part 13. This announcement with its attachments constitutes the only solicitation; proposals are being requested and a written solicitation will not be issued.


(II) This solicitation is issued as a request for quotation (RFQ). Submit written quotes on RFQ Number AG-447U-S-15-0016.


(III) The solicitation document and incorporated provisions and clauses are those in effect through Federal Acquisition Circular 2005-33.

(IV) This solicitation is being issued as a Total Small Business Set-Aside. The associated NAICS code is 561720, Janitorial Services. The small business size standard is $16.5 million.

(V) This is for a single award Indefinite Delivery Indefinite Quantity (IDIQ) contract for Janitorial Services in accordance with the schedule of items, specifications, terms and conditions.
